Welcome to the Montana Frontier History Auction. Our two-day sale features a vast assortment of items.
Day 1: Cowboy Spurs, Bits, Indian Beadwork, Turquoise Jewelry, Navajo Rugs, Indian Artifacts, Chinese and Asian Objects, Tokens, Coins, Montana Photography and Historical Items, Band Signed Photos and Backstage Passes, Flags, Books, Rugs, Blankets, Textiles, and so much more.
Also included in Day 1 is a large selection of artworks from the Estate of Frederick Kress a notable California Artist.

Other featured artists include: Ace Powell, Bob Scriver, Taylor Lynde, Dave Powell, Tom Saubert, Les Peters, and Ralph Earl Decamp. A highlight of our art portion is the addition of an original Rembrandt etching of Jan Lutma.

Other lots of note include two industry award medals, given to Colorado Territory Gunsmith FW Freund for his accomplishments.

Day 2: Our Military and Firearm Day. Including a 7th Cavalry Montana Campaign Hat, a Signal Corps Messenger Pigeon Cage, Collection of Vietnam War Theater Made Patches, and many more unique and historical items.
